What is a Lab Report?

A lab report documents the details of an experiment, providing a thorough description of the procedures followed and the outcomes observed. These reports are crucial for:

  • Demonstrating the experiment’s methodology and results.
  • Enabling others to replicate the experiment.
  • Communicating findings and their implications clearly.

Purpose of a Lab Report

A lab report aims to:

  • Conduct thorough scientific research.
  • Formulate and test hypotheses.
  • Provide detailed methodology for reproducibility.
  • Analyze results methodically.
  • Communicate findings effectively.

Lab Report Format

Basic Formatting Rules

  • Double-spacing of the text.
  • 12-point font size.
  • Page numbers on each page.
  • Clear arguments linking sections cohesively.

Title Page

Include the title of the experiment, your name, the date, and any other relevant information.

Abstract

A brief summary (50-150 words) outlining the purpose of the experiment, key methods, results, and conclusions.

Introduction

Provide background information on the topic, state the hypothesis, and outline the aims of the experiment.

Equipment List

List all materials and equipment used in the experiment.

Procedures

Detail the steps followed during the experiment in a way that allows replication.

Method

Divide this section into:

  1. Participants: Number, recruitment method, and demographics.
  2. Design: Independent and dependent variables.
  3. Materials: List all materials and measures, including questionnaires if used.

Data

Present raw numerical data in tables, without interpretation.

Graphs and Figures

Label graphs and figures with titles, and refer to them in the text. Include titles below figures and above tables.

Discussion or Analysis

Interpret the data, discuss whether the hypothesis was supported, mention any errors, and suggest future research directions.

References

List all references used, following APA style:

  • Books: Author, A. A. (year). Title of work. Location: Publisher.
  • Journal Articles: Author, A. A., Author, B. B., & Author, C. C. (year). Article title. Journal Title, volume number(issue number), page numbers.

Results

Clearly and concisely report the results of the experiments, including any relevant calculations or equations.

Conclusion

Summarize the findings and their implications, and conclude with a statement based on the experimental data.

Steps to Write a Lab Report

  1. Define Primary Goal: Ensure your report is easy to read and understand.
  2. Identify the Audience: Tailor explanations to the knowledge level of your readers.
  3. Draft Your Report: Follow the outlined format and structure.
  4. Revise: Check for accuracy, clarity, and any errors.

Lab Report Writing Tips

  • Be clear and concise.
  • Avoid irrelevant information and personal opinions.
  • Support statements with evidence.
  • Write in the past tense.
